diff --git a/app/src/main/java/com/futo/platformplayer/fragment/mainactivity/main/BuyFragment.kt b/app/src/main/java/com/futo/platformplayer/fragment/mainactivity/main/BuyFragment.kt index 5eecc4a5..db93fce9 100644 --- a/app/src/main/java/com/futo/platformplayer/fragment/mainactivity/main/BuyFragment.kt +++ b/app/src/main/java/com/futo/platformplayer/fragment/mainactivity/main/BuyFragment.kt @@ -10,6 +10,7 @@ import android.widget.TextView import androidx.lifecycle.lifecycleScope import com.futo.futopay.PaymentConfigurations import com.futo.futopay.PaymentManager +import com.futo.platformplayer.BuildConfig import com.futo.platformplayer.R import com.futo.platformplayer.UIDialogs import com.futo.platformplayer.logging.Logger @@ -68,9 +69,12 @@ class BuyFragment : MainFragment() { } } - _buttonBuy.setOnClickListener { - buy(); - } + if(!BuildConfig.IS_PLAYSTORE_BUILD) + _buttonBuy.setOnClickListener { + buy(); + } + else + _buttonBuy.visibility = View.GONE; _buttonPaid.setOnClickListener { paid(); } diff --git a/app/src/main/java/com/futo/platformplayer/fragment/mainactivity/main/SourceDetailFragment.kt b/app/src/main/java/com/futo/platformplayer/fragment/mainactivity/main/SourceDetailFragment.kt index 50fbe05d..8c9604aa 100644 --- a/app/src/main/java/com/futo/platformplayer/fragment/mainactivity/main/SourceDetailFragment.kt +++ b/app/src/main/java/com/futo/platformplayer/fragment/mainactivity/main/SourceDetailFragment.kt @@ -263,10 +263,18 @@ class SourceDetailFragment : MainFragment() { BigButtonGroup(c, "Management", BigButton(c, "Uninstall", "Removes the plugin from the app", R.drawable.ic_block) { uninstallSource(); - }.withBackground(R.drawable.background_big_button_red), + }.withBackground(R.drawable.background_big_button_red).apply { + this.layoutParams = LinearLayout.LayoutParams(LinearLayout.LayoutParams.MATCH_PARENT, LinearLayout.LayoutParams.WRAP_CONTENT).apply { + setMargins(0, TypedValue.applyDimension(TypedValue.COMPLEX_UNIT_DIP, 5f, resources.displayMetrics).toInt(), 0, 0); + }; + }, if(clientIfExists?.captchaEncrypted != null) - BigButton(c, "Delete Captcha", "Deletes captcha for this plugin", R.drawable.ic_block) { + BigButton(c, "Delete Captcha", "Deletes stored captcha answer for this plugin", R.drawable.ic_block) { clientIfExists?.updateCaptcha(null); + }.apply { + this.layoutParams = LinearLayout.LayoutParams(LinearLayout.LayoutParams.MATCH_PARENT, LinearLayout.LayoutParams.WRAP_CONTENT).apply { + setMargins(0, TypedValue.applyDimension(TypedValue.COMPLEX_UNIT_DIP, 5f, resources.displayMetrics).toInt(), 0, 0); + }; }.withBackground(R.drawable.background_big_button_red) else null )